pangeachat / client

Learn a language while texting your friends
https://krille-chan.github.io/fluffychat/
GNU Affero General Public License v3.0
2 stars 2 forks source link

Clicking a word should give practice on that word #1049

Open wcjord opened 3 days ago

wcjord commented 3 days ago

TO TEST: Click a word on a message. The toolbar show open to a word meaning practice activity with that message unless you've already done that kind of activity with that word within the last 24 hours.

linhtphung commented 2 days ago

I haven't seen this happen. When I clicked on a word that I know I haven't practiced on, this just spins. image @wcjord

linhtphung commented 2 days ago

This works on testflight staging

ggurdin commented 7 hours ago

This doesn't seem to work on Android

wcjord commented 7 hours ago

@ggurdin I'd like your help with this please!

ggurdin commented 7 hours ago

On it!

ggurdin commented 7 hours ago

It's a bit confusing that even when I click on a word, it still checks if that word is qualified for an activity. For instance, the word "podrias" in a bot message had no eligible activity types, so I didn't get an activity for that word.

Would it make sense to have less strict rules for deciding whether to give a clicked-on token an activity? (One worry in this case would be the user unintentionally clicking on a word that they don't want/need to practice because they want to select the message, not the specific word where their cursor/thumb landed)

ggurdin commented 6 hours ago

That seems to be the issue. Clicking on a wed to get an activity works when activities are available/enabled for a given token. But they're not available for a large number of tokens, so it's confusing.

wcjord commented 6 hours ago

Yup, was wrestling with this. The rules are less strict currently. Potentially they should be even less strict. Obviously confusing for you as a test user.

Will Jordan-Cooley CEO and Founder Pangea Chat https://www.pangeachat.com

On Fri, Nov 22, 2024 at 4:15 PM ggurdin @.***> wrote:

It's a bit confusing that even when I click on a word, it still checks if that word is qualified for an activity. For instance, the word "podrias" in a bot message had no eligible activity types, so I didn't get an activity for that word.

Would it make sense to have less strict rules for deciding whether to give a clicked-on token an activity? (One worry in this case would be the user unintentionally clicking on a word that they don't want/need to practice because they want to select the message, not the specific word where their cursor/thumb landed)

— Reply to this email directly, view it on GitHub https://github.com/pangeachat/client/issues/1049#issuecomment-2494822801, or unsubscribe https://github.com/notifications/unsubscribe-auth/AHYPKFNNEUPR3TSP6JJOBC32B6NF5AVCNFSM6AAAAABSCVYGOKVHI2DSMVQWIX3LMV43OSLTON2WKQ3PNVWWK3TUHMZDIOJUHAZDEOBQGE . You are receiving this because you modified the open/close state.Message ID: @.***>